rbayliss commentedYou can find the Uberpos receipt template in the themes directory (uberpos-print-receipt.tpl.php). You can also do some modification on the header/footer in the Uberpos settings control panel. Unfortunately, the product output isn't themeable at the moment for the receipt or the screen interface, but I'll mark this a feature request to be addressed soon.
